Benefits of COUNTER Reports in the Publishing Industry

Benefits of COUNTER Reports

COUNTER, which stands for “Counting Online Usage of Networked Electronic Resources,” is an international non-profit membership organization of libraries, publishers, and vendors. All the members continually develop a Code of Practice, which provides the standard for the knowledge community to use consistent, comparable, and standardized usage data.  COUNTER has successfully ensured that vendors and publishers across the world are able to provide their respective customers with accurate statistics regarding various content types, including databases, journals, articles, books, and multimedia.

Originally, the COUNTER standard was created to assist librarians who buy various subscriptions for their members. The primary objective was to help them easily compare the usage of various subscriptions from multiple publishers. It helped them analyze the usage pattern of content across types, genres, fields, etc. This information was also used in order to arrive at a particular metric called “cost per download” for each subscription. It was a measure of the return on investment for a particular subscription or content piece and which, in turn, helped the libraries optimize their budget allocations.

Even though the usage of COUNTER reports by libraries was the most common, some publishers also gradually began to use them. These standardized reports are now widely used by publishers to understand usage patterns across various subscribers, geographies, demographics, etc.

In addition to providing a standardized set of reports on usage information, COUNTER assists librarians and publishers by

  • offering subscription renewal information
  • tracking the value of library resources
  • analyzing and enhancing user behavior
  • providing comparable usage statistics to customers
  • informing authors about the usage of their publications.

COUNTER Benefits

Tracking Usage: Usage data is generated using two approaches:

Page tags are small JavaScript codes that are embedded within every page of a website. Information is gathered from these codes and compiled in a database. This data can give additional information about content users, enabling publishers to gauge their customers’ navigation, or buying behavior.

Log files represent individual HTTP requests, IP addresses, browser information, request dates and times, and so forth. Log files are stored on clients’ servers, enabling them to use any analytic program to receive consistent results. Additionally, they are independent of their customers’ browsers, ensuring that publishers can reliably track any data for COUNTER reporting.

Data Processing: COUNTER ensures that only valid page requests are counted and that any bad requests are excluded. Only relevant content types, such as books or their supplementary files, are counted, not images or style sheets.

Comparable Reports: Since the definitions of collecting the usage statistics are standardized, the COUNTER reports are independent of any vendor-specific formats and can be compared across different service providers.

Portable Formats: As part of the standardization, report formats are strictly defined and adhered to, and can be easily used by different data analysis tools.
